'Wow': England star reveals he 'admires' €81m Liverpool-duo and hails Lallana's 'Cruyff turns'

Unlike in previous seasons, Liverpool's attacking midfielders have hit the ground running this season, and Nathaniel Clyne admits he's impressed by the skill he sees every day in training.

Speaking to the Daily Mail this week, Clyne enthused:

"I often watch our attacking players and think 'Wow'. You have to admire it. Firmino’s touch, Coutinho jinking around, Mane taking on players, Lallana doing Cruyff turns. I see it all the time at the training ground, and it’s good to watch".

Yes, it's good to watch, but for me, Lallana's 'Cruyff turns' = pointless showboating that often achieves nothing. In fact, I don't recall a single instance in the last two years when a Lallana Cruyff turn actually led (directly or indirectly) to a goal or an assist for Liverpool.

As for 'Firmino's touch' - Clyne must be watching a different player because the Brazilian's first touch is often a weak spot during games. Indeed, over the last year, Firmino's ball control stats are the worst in Liverpool's squad (OPTA).

What cannot be denied, though, the collective impact this season of Mane, Lallana, Coutino, and Firmino, and at the end of the day, that's what it's all about. Combined stats this season:

* Total LFC goals scored this season = 26

* Mane, Lallana, Coutinho, and Firmino contribution = 14 goals/12 assists (26) in 8 games.

Pretty impressive, and this prodigious creative return will hopefully continue against Man Utd on Monday.
